Abstract: | The effect of quenching on the electrical resistivity and optical properties of MoTe2 compound was studied. Significant changes were detected in the behaviour and value of the electrical resistivity, indicating an increase in the metallic (conductive) properties of the compound, which is in good agreement with the data of optical measurements. © 2019 Published under licence by IOP Publishing Ltd. |
